Everyday carry—EDC—is evolving, and with it the demand for discreet body armor. Traditional options like bulletproof vests, armored T-shirts, and plate carriers are often bulky, uncomfortable, and difficult to conceal.
Enter the Bodyguard CCW Armored Jacket from Bodyguard Concealed Armor Systems—designed as a practical, affordable way to integrate ballistic protection seamlessly into your daily routine and EDC loadout. With its patent-pending Hidden Draw System (HDS), it claims to offer a tactical advantage no other armored jacket can match.

HDS is designed to allow you to access your concealed firearm without tipping off a potential threat. At first glance, it appears as if you’re complying—placing your hand into a standard front pocket. But that pocket serves as an ingeniously designed false front, giving you instant, covert access to your weapon. With a breakaway feature built into the pocket, the jacket enables a natural, fluid draw, so there’s no need to modify your existing training.
Designed for full front and back centerline protection, the Bodyguard CCW Armored Jacket features discreet armor pockets that hold standard 10×12” Level 3A panels. The patent-pending Concealed Armor System (CAS) allows you to insert or remove armor as needed, keeping you protected without sacrificing mobility or comfort. Combining this with the Hidden Draw System results in a one-of-a-kind armored CCW jacket that offers both defensive and offensive readiness—all at an accessible price point.

Bodyguard Concealed Armor Systems points out that for body armor to be effective, you first have to want to wear it. If it’s too cumbersome or attracts unwanted attention, it will most likely stay in the closet. That’s why Bodyguard jackets are designed to fit effortlessly into your everyday life and offer you discreet protection that works under extreme stress. The Hidden Draw System is designed to be instinctive, allowing you to maintain your natural draw mechanics regardless of carry position or dominant hand.
The Bodyguard CCW Armored Jacket is available with or without armor, giving you the flexibility to use your own panels. When heading into high-risk areas, simply throw it on just like you would any other jacket. You can just as easily remove it when you reach safety. And unlike traditional armor solutions, Bodyguard jackets are TSA-compliant, allowing you to travel freely through airport security.
